How are the coordinates for a new waypoint calculated?


Are these just the actual measured GPS- coords, or is it possible to make a lot of measures (about half a minute or so) and calculate the waypoint from the average of this measurements? I would like the last very much, but didn`t find how to...

thanks berkley, exactly! Locus itself do not apply any filter on coordinates. So if you store new waypoint in Locus, it`s just one coordinate pair Locus received from GPS. For some averaging, follow berkley`s link for 3rd party program that works also together with Locus
